Overview

Government departments are recruiting dependable Cleaners to maintain hygienic, safe and welcoming facilities for staff and the public. Roles cover routine cleaning of offices, clinics, hospitals and shared spaces, with strict adherence to health, safety and infection-prevention standards.

Key Responsibilities

-Sweep, mop, vacuum, dust and wipe all assigned areas to prescribed standards.

-Clean and sanitise ablutions, kitchens, offices, board/meeting rooms and high-touch surfaces.

-Empty bins, remove refuse/recyclables, and keep corridors, stairs, entrances and lobbies tidy.

-Clean windows/mirrors/glass; spot-clean stains and spills promptly; operate basic cleaning equipment.

-Safely use/store chemicals and equipment; set out signage (e.g., wet-floor).

-Follow daily/weekly schedules, complete basic checklists, report defects and hazards.

-Support stock control of consumables and assist with venue set-ups when required.

Minimum Requirements

-Basic literacy and numeracy (minimum ABET/NQF Level 2 or Grade 9; some posts accept ABET Level 4/Grade 10; see listings).

-Physical fitness to lift/move equipment and perform manual tasks.

-Good communication and teamwork; reliability and attention to detail.

-Knowledge of basic cleaning methods, tools, chemicals and PPE (advantageous).

-Availability for shifts/weekends/public holidays as operationally required.
